How Do You Angle a Dewalt Table Saw?

Most woodworkers will tell you that there are three basic cuts you can make with a table saw: rip, crosscut and miter. Ripping is cutting along the length of the grain. You would use this type of cut when you’re trying to turn a piece of lumber into boards or strips.

For example, if you’re making your own bookshelves, you’ll need to rip the lumber down into planks that are all the same width. Crosscutting is cutting across the grain. This is what you would do if you’re taking a board and cutting it down to size so that it’s more manageable.

For example, if you’re making a coffee table, you might need to crosscut the boards to create pieces that are all the same length. Miter cuts are angled cuts (hence the name). These are often used for molding or trim work.

For example, if you’re putting up baseboards in your home, you’ll likely use miter cuts to get clean, sharp corners where the baseboard meets the wall.

How Do You Use a Table Saw at Home?

Assuming you would like tips on how to use a table saw in the home woodworking shop: Table saws are one of the most versatile tools in a woodworker’s arsenal, and there’s good reason for that. With the right blade, a table saw can make rip cuts, crosscuts, miters, and even Dados with ease.

That said, they can also be one of the most dangerous tools in your shop if used improperly. So before you start cutting, let’s go over some basics on how to use a table saw safely. First and foremost, always use personal protective equipment (PPE) when working with power tools.

This includes eye protection, hearing protection, and gloves. Second, be sure to read the owner’s manual that came with your table saw before using it. There will be specific instructions on how to set up and operate your particular model safely.

Thirdly, never work alone in the shop – make sure someone else is around in case of an accident. Finally, take your time and focus on what you’re doing while operating any power tool; rushing leads to mistakes which could result in serious injury. Now that we have those safety considerations out of the way, let’s talk about actually using the tool.

The first step is setting up your workspace; you want to be sure that yourtable saw is level and stable before cutting anything. Once that’s done, it’s time to choose the right blade for the job at hand – there are many different types available depending on what kind of cut you need to make. Be sure to install the blade correctly accordingto manufacturer instructions (i.e., tighten all bolts securely).

Now you can finally start making some cuts! When making rip cuts (cutting along the length of a board), Always use a fence(guide) placed parallel tothe blade; this will ensure more accurate cuts and help prevent kickback (whenthe board gets flung back at you violently). For crosscuts (cutting acrossthe grain), place either a miter gauge or crosscut sled perpendicular toboththe fence and blade; again this provides greater accuracy and preventskickback by holding the workpiece firmly against both guides simultaneouslywhile cutting through it evenly from both sides.

How Do You Use a Dewalt Circular Saw?

When it comes to using a Dewalt circular saw, there are a few things that you need to keep in mind. First of all, make sure that you have the right blade for the job. There are different blades for different materials, so you need to make sure that you’re using the correct one.

Secondly, always use safety goggles and gloves when operating the saw. And finally, be very careful when making cuts – never force the blade and take your time. With these tips in mind, let’s take a look at how to actually use a Dewalt circular saw.

To start, set the depth of cut on the saw by loosening or tightening the knob at the front of the tool. Next, rest the blade on the material that you’re going to be cutting and make sure that it is lined up with your mark. Then, switch on the saw and slowly lower it down onto the material.

Apply gentle pressure as you move forwards and keep an eye on your line. When you reach the end of your cut, lift up the blade and switch off the power. Always remember to unplug your tools before changing blades!
